Early Life and Musical Journey

Jon Batiste was born into a musical family, which greatly influenced his career path. His mother was a pianist, and his father played the trumpet. Batiste began playing the piano at a young age and quickly developed a passion for jazz. He attended the New Orleans Center for Creative Arts, where he honed his skills and was exposed to various musical styles.

After high school, Batiste moved to New York City to attend the Juilliard School, where he studied jazz and graduated with a degree in music. His time at Juilliard allowed him to collaborate with other talented musicians, further enriching his musical knowledge and experience.

Career Highlights

Jon Batiste's career took off when he formed the band "Stay Human" in 2005. The band gained prominence through their energetic performances and unique blend of genres. In 2015, Batiste became the bandleader for "The Late Show with Stephen Colbert," which significantly increased his visibility in the music industry.

In 2021, Batiste released his album "We Are," which received critical acclaim and earned him several Grammy nominations. The album showcased his versatility as a musician and included a mix of genres, reflecting his diverse musical influences.

Musical Style and Influences

Jon Batiste's musical style is a fusion of various genres, including jazz, R&B, soul, and pop. He draws inspiration from legendary artists such as Louis Armstrong, Duke Ellington, and Stevie Wonder, which is evident in his innovative compositions and arrangements.

His ability to blend traditional jazz elements with contemporary sounds has earned him recognition as a modern music innovator. Batiste often incorporates storytelling into his music, addressing social issues and personal experiences, making his songs relatable and impactful.
